luke has $1.40 in quarters and nickels. he has 2 more quarters than nickels. how many coins of each type does he have?
Ainat [17]

Answer:

3 nickels and 5 quarters

Step-by-step explanation:

Let n = number of nickels

q = number of quarters

q = n+2

.25q + .05n = 1.40

Using the first equation and replacing q in the second equation

.25( n+2) + .05n = 1.40

Distribute

.25n+.50 +.05n = 1.40

Combine like terms

.30n +.5 = 1.40

Subtract .5 from each side

.3n +.5-.5 = 1.40-.4

.3n = .9

Divide by .3

.3n/.3 = .9/.3

n = 3

q = n+2

q=5
